FAQ — When can the loading dock accept deliveries overnight?

The Calloway Yard dock is formally open 06:00–16:00, but night-shift staff may accept pre-booked deliveries between 22:00 and 04:00, provided the booking appears in the DockTrak schedule and the driver's reference matches. Do not open the roller door for unscheduled arrivals — redirect them to the morning window. Always complete the overnight ledger before the vehicle leaves the yard. To release the roller door from the night-side control panel, enter the following pass code:

door code, yagap-bahof: bdg-O-05

Subject: Font vendoring cut-over complete

Hi on-call — tonight we finished moving Brindlewick's third-party fonts from the external CDN into our own asset bundle. All pages now load fonts from the vendored path; the old CDN references were removed in the final deploy. If you see layout shifts or missing glyphs, roll back the asset service only, not the web tier. The asset service currently runs with the configuration below.

config for kafof-bawef:
holath:
  log_level: debug
  metrics_host: metrics.holath.qorvelsys.internal
  pin: 2191
  pool_size: 32

**TICKET PRL-2291: Config drift causing flaky DNS resolution in Quillhaven resolver pods**

The Quillhaven lookup service intermittently fails to resolve upstream hosts after the last redeploy. Root cause: resolver timeout and retry settings drifted between the staging template and the live nodes, so some pods cache stale answers. Future maintainers: reconcile against the canonical template before patching anything else. The currently deployed values are as follows.

service settings:
PRAIX_LOG_LEVEL=error
PRAIX_METRICS_HOST=metrics.praix.qorvelcorp.corp
PRAIX_POOL_SIZE=16

Runbook fragment — Lanternfield consent banner rollout. Before enabling the banner for the next cohort, confirm the policy bundle hash matches staging, verify that declined-consent events suppress all analytics writes, and capture a screenshot of the banner in both locales. Log each verification in the rollout sheet. For audit traceability, record the deploy identifier shown below.

trace token, fafog-kageg: htk4_98e6